Hi, There is something mysterious in tar with Cygwin when archive contains hard links. Similar issues have been reported earlier: http://sourceware.org/ml/cygwin/2006-12/msg00251.html http://sourceware.org/ml/cygwin/2007-01/msg00705.html In my case, a colleague was trying to extract a pre-built cross-toolchain on his brand new WinXP laptop from a tarball I had created earlier. This tarball extracts just fine on all tried systems except this one. Cygwin setup is exactly the same as in other computers (installed from same set of packages burnt on CD-R). Cygwin root is on NTFS filesystem. Creating hard links manually using ln works fine, but tar cannot extract hard links from an archive, giving errors like: tar: bar: Cannot hard link to 'foo': File exists Updating to current tar (1.20) gives the exact same behavior, but made it possible to circumvent the problem by repackaging the files with the new --hard-dereference option. /TS -- Unsubscribe info: http://cygwin.com/ml/#unsubscribe-simple Problem reports: http://cygwin.com/problems.html Documentation: http://cygwin.com/docs.html FAQ: http://cygwin.com/faq/
